Sub-Varsity volleyball teams turn in winning performances

The sub varsity volleyball teams turned in winning performances last week, going three for three in matches. Both the ninth and junior varsity squads defeated Trinity on the road on Tuesday. The junior varsity also handed Wortham a loss on Friday.
The Lady Bison dropped the first set to Trinity’s ninth graders 22-25, but stormed back to earn a 25-6, 25-17 victory. Raven Lott served for sixteen points, including a ten point in the second set. Heather Humphries, Kylen Armstrong and Erin Trahan all served for eight. Zelneisha Lockett and Lott both had strong hitting performances. Trahan stepped in for an absent setter and helped Humphries with setting duties.
The junior varsity Lady Bison outlasted the Tigers in both sets 25-21, 25-21. Tionna Adams and Reagan Read paced Buffalo with eleven and ten service points. Samantha Atkinson, Read, Emily Grissett and Haley Ellison notched kills in the match while Adams and Laken Mc- Cabe set up the attack. Hannah Wilson, Kayla Ward and Heather Sigert provided top passing in the win.
Buffalo wrapped up an undefeated week in volleyball with a 25-19, 25-17 victory over Wortham. McCabe served it up for thirteen points in the match. Read finished with six service points.
“It isn’t often that a school goes undefeated for the week,” said head coach Lori Shaw. “The Lady Bison did just that, winning nine matches from seven B through varsity. It was a great effort by every team.”
